Piracy is not a victimless crime. Legal firms and government agencies actively pursue software pirates. In a notable case, three employees of a Long Island IT company pleaded guilty to criminal copyright infringement for using "cracking" programs to install unlicensed software. The company agreed to pay a $60,000 fine , and the defendants faced up to a year in prison. Those caught using pirated software can face lawsuits, hefty fines, or other legal actions, with businesses being particularly vulnerable to software audits initiated by organizations like the Business Software Alliance (BSA).
